Pierre Gasly found himself top of the timing sheets in the final practice session for the Turkish Grand Prix, ahead of the Red Bull pairing of Max Verstappen and Sergio Perez.
A wet start to Saturday meant that the drivers headed out on track on full wet tyres, before changing over to intermediates as the track began to dry slightly, with Gasly mastering the conditions to go fastest ahead of qualifying.
FP3: Gasly fastest over Verstappen in wet final Turkish GP practice session
Others weren’t so fortunate, with George Russell an early casualty after beaching his Williams FW43B in the gravel and bringing out a red flag – while there were also spins for the likes of Verstappen, Charles Leclerc and Nikita Mazepin.
